I had a really special moment with Pippin (feral dog) the other day. As we have had him longer he has come to trust us in many different ways, but somethings have always been very difficult for him to overcome.

The first time he choose to have any kind of physical attention from a person was about 2 years after he came to us. He walked up to Mum while she was on the phone to me and rested his head in her hand - had us both in floods of tears.

After 9 years I still get a buzz when he comes for a fuss - and he will allow you to touch him all around his head and neck , but he cannot cope if you go to his back or his rear end Unless its first thing in the morning and you are in bed!)

However - the other day he was settled on the sofa (flat out) and I walked past - as I moved towards him (normally he would tense ready to bolt) he lifted his back leg for me to stroke his tummy. It was the most amazing thing - I tickled his belly for a few mins and then walked away and he stayed there.

Its very odd -writing it out like this is seems like nothing....but it was a huge thing on his part to stay relaxed on his side while a person was bending over him.

He has had lots of special moments through his life - but this was a major one for me.
